Hideaki Hagino
is a former Japanese football Football is a family of team sports that involve, to varying degrees, kicking a ball to score a goal. Unqualified, the word ''football'' normally means the form of football that is the most popular where the word is used. Sports commonly c ... player. Playing career Hagino was born in Hokkaido on January 20, 1973. After graduating from Sapporo University, he joined Sanfrecce Hiroshima in 1995. On April 22, he debuted against Urawa Reds. However he could only play this match until 1996 and he retired end of 1996 season. Kosuke Hagino
is a Japanese former competitive swimmer who specialized in the individual medley and 200 m freestyle. He is a four-time Olympic medalist, most notably winning gold in the 400 m individual medley at the 2016 Summer Olympics. Hagino holds the Asian Records in the 400 m individual medley (long course), the 100 m and 200 m individual medley (short course). With Team Japan, he holds the Asian Record for the 4×100 m freestyle relay (short course). Hagino attends Toyo University, and is coached by Norimasa Hirai. He is one of the only two Asians to have been voted World Swimmer of the Year. Background and personal Kosuke Hagino was born in Tochigi, Tochigi, Japan on 15 August 1994. He married the singer miwa in 2019 fall and the couple has been expecting a child; its birth expected some time in 2019 winter.
